I've now done four bookings wearing a wig. The first one I decided that the wig wasn't working for me, but I have several wigs and I tried a different one. It worked OK but I felt uneasy and unsure.

When I had my own long hair it wasn't uncommon for a client to accidentally pin me with an elbow on my hair. So I want to avoid that happening. I am sticking to shoulder-length wigs.

The rolling around bit is the part that worries me. I feel much more constrained. I need to figure out ways to pin the thing securely to my head. Right now I have a stocking cap to keep the hair around my temples under the wig (I have a short bob that swings forward at the jawline). I think the stocking cap makes for more heat and greater slippage. I'm going to try a thin elastic hair band, instead - it's really only the bit around the ears that needs holding back.

I'm not sure how to hold the wig on, other than the elastic band inside the thing.

Fabulosity , you can buy the little clips that hold clip in hair extentions in , separately about 20p each they have holes on each end that a needle fits through and you can sew then on the forehead / front part of wig underneath and also at the sides and nape , you need about six and as you slide wig on the grip your real hair tight then do the same with sides and back , I did it when I had a few little bald spots from alopecia ....it won't budge even if someone tugged it or your in a hurricane and they can't be seen at all  ;) xx

I'm not getting on with the sewn in comb/clips. Not sure what I am doing wrong. However, two criss-crossed bobby pins at each temple seems to do the trick. I think I may try to put one clip at the nape of the neck to stop it feeling like it's riding up. But the bobby pins are sufficient to hold it on my head.

The clients don't seem to mind! I saw a regular this morning and he just thought I'd styled my hair differently.

And I'm getting used to wearing the thing. It's less itchy and hot than it was. As I grow more confident about it, I guess I just think about it less.
